Inhibitory effect of LXR activation on cell proliferation and cell cycle progression through lipogenic activity.
Liver X receptor (LXR), a sterol-activated nuclear hormone receptor, has been implicated in cholesterol and fatty acid homeostasis via regulation of reverse cholesterol transport and de novo fatty acid synthesis. LXR is also involved in immune responses, including anti-inflammatory action and T cell proliferation. In this study, we demonstrated that activated LXR suppresses cell cycle progressi...
متن کاملA splice variant of cyclin D2 regulates cardiomyocyte cell cycle through a novel protein aggregation pathway.
The mammalian heart lacks intrinsic ability to replace diseased myocardium with newly divided myocytes. There is scant information on mechanisms regulating cell cycle exit in cardiomyocytes. We cloned a splice variant of cyclin D2 (D2SV) from the mouse heart and found a novel role for this protein in cardiomyocyte cell cycle exit. We report that D2SV is highly expressed in embryonic myocardium ...
متن کاملAcetylation of cyclin A: a new cell cycle regulatory mechanism.
Cyclin A must be degraded at prometaphase in order to allow mitosis progression. Nevertheless, the signals that trigger cyclin A degradation at mitosis have been largely elusive. In the present paper, we review the status of cyclin A degradation in the light of recent evidence indicating that acetylation plays a role in cyclin A stability. The emerging model proposes that the acetyltransferase ...
متن کاملBoth cyclin A and cyclin E have S-phase promoting (SPF) activity in Xenopus egg extracts.
Extracts of activated Xenopus eggs in which protein synthesis has been inhibited support a single round of chromosomal DNA replication. Affinity-depletion of cyclin dependent kinases (Cdks) from these extracts blocks the initiation of DNA replication. We define 'S-phase promoting factor' (SPF) as the Cdk activity required for DNA replication in these Cdk-depleted extracts. Recombinant cyclins A...
متن کاملCell cycle diversity involves differential regulation of Cyclin E activity in the Drosophila bristle cell lineage.
In the Drosophila bristle lineage, five differentiated cells arise from a precursor cell after a rapid sequence of asymmetric cell divisions (one every 2 hours). We show that, in mitotic cells, this rapid cadence of cell divisions is associated with cell cycles essentially devoid of the G1-phase. This feature is due to the expression of Cyclin E that precedes each cell division, and the differe...
